Behind most kind of ‘nothing’, we all have a story that was once ‘everything’. The beauty of nothingness is that we get completely submerged into it. That is what the feeling of Void is. The V in Void silently says that it encompasses the ‘we’ in it. One is not alone and there is something else with it. May be another person, expectation, object, etc, that kind of else thing.
When we are left with a void, we are left behind with an opportunity. Void is happiness because we dig up an occasion to fill it with our wish. We could fill joy or otherwise. Or we could just leave it void. Either way one or the other is going to fill for us. It is always advisable that we have our void in our control and plug it the way we need.
